How Memory Care Facilities Can Help

According to the Alzheimer’s Association, 83% of all caregivers are unpaid family members, relatives, or other friends, and nearly half of all care is for older adults with some form of dementia. Caregiving, especially when it involves Alzheimer’s or dementia, is extremely exhausting and time consuming, leading many caregivers to feel isolated and overwhelmed.

As a loved one continues to progress through the stages of dementia and his or her cognitive abilities continue to decline, behavioral problems, safety, and general care often become more than one caregiver can handle. This is when it’s important to find extra help, and residential facilities that have specialized memory care programs are often the best solution.

In addition to providing a safe environment, memory care programs seek to delay or halt cognitive decline while providing the opportunity for a social, independent lifestyle.

Brookdale St. Augustine is housed in a Georgian-style mansion surrounded by beautifully landscaped gardens. The Clare Bridge memory care unit is located in a secure section of the building that has access to a safe outdoor area. The unit requires a security code for entry and exit. A team of dedicated caregiving staff and licensed nurses is always on hand to provide assistance with personal care tasks or medication management. The unit uses the Life Story program to bring purpose and joy into the lives of residents. This system assesses where the resident is currently in their personal history due to their cognitive disorder, and the staff creates customized activities for them that suit that part of their lives. Three home-cooked meals are served on a daily basis, and the staff can assist residents with meals when required.
